Dead Key Fob Battery

Key fobs have made locking and starting cars much more convenient, but they can also be a hassle when the battery goes bad. This is a problem that a lot of people encounter at some point but it doesn't need to be a huge issue when you have some simple tricks up your sleeve.

One of the most obvious indicators that your key fob needs replacement batteries is if it no longer lights up when you press one of the buttons. This is a crucial feature to pay attention to because if it stops working, you won't be able to open the doors, open the trunk, or start the car without the physical key.

Another sign that your key fob is about to fail is if it begins to take a while to respond after pressing one of the buttons. This could be due to the fact that the battery has aged and is no longer able to provide enough power to run the buttons. Keep a spare battery in your wallet, so you can replace it in the event that this occurs.

There are several options to consider if your key fob battery is dead and the first step is to open it manually with the mechanical key that is stored inside. Some keys are stored inside the fob however others can be found under the handle cover on the door or in a slot on the dashboard. If you're not sure of where to look, you can check your owner's manual or search online for "how to extract the mechanical key from a (year model and make) fob" and you should find plenty of useful information and videos.

Once you have the mechanical key, you can then use a small screwdriver to pry open the key fob and access the battery. You'll want to be careful when doing this so that you don't hurt anything else during the process. After you've removed the battery that was used, replace it with a new CR2032 battery with the positive side facing upwards.

Key Fob Issues

The key fob is an intricate piece that has many delicate parts that are difficult to repair or replace. Although they are typically constructed with care, it may happen that they lose function and require replacement or reprogramming from the manufacturer or a skilled auto locksmith. A spare remote can help you avoid a key fob malfunction that causes a issue.

The most frequent reason for a key fob that isn't working is that the batteries have failed. Replacing the battery is a quick and affordable solution. However, the issue may be more serious such as a defective contact or worn button.

A key fob has an electronic circuit board and an elastic button cover that has tiny pads that conduct electricity and batteries. There are remote key fob repair of batteries, however the majority contain lithium-ion coins cells. They are available at pharmacies, supermarkets and home improvement stores. It is simple to change the batteries, but you should be careful not to cause harm to the delicate circuits.

If a replacement battery isn't able to solve the issue, remove the key fob and then take it apart for an extensive inspection. Look for indications of corrosion or damage to the battery contacts and terminals. Clean the battery terminals and contact points by using Isopropyl Alcohol or Methylhydrate. Soldering them back into place can restore their functionality. You can also try bending up slightly the little metal fingers on the circuit board that come into contact with the battery to increase their power.

The battery you bought might not be the right type for your key fob. Key fobs have been designed to fit specific sizes, voltages and mAh capacities of batteries. If you use the wrong battery, it will not only not charge, but also stop it from sending strong signals or powering its internal switches. Look over the labels of the battery that you have used before or the owner's manual to see what type of battery you require.

You'll need to bring your fob to an auto locksmith in order to have it changed. They will be able to determine whether the issue is with the fob itself or with the locks of the vehicle or electronic systems.

Key Fob Replacement

A dealership is typically the only option when you require an alternative car key fob. This is because the fob contains a transponder that transmits the code that powers the ignition and lock systems. It emits a unique code when it's pressed by the immobilizer that your car recognizes. If you lose your car keys or the fob battery fails, it can make your vehicle unstartable.

Dealerships have the ability to reprogram most fobs. However, this can be expensive. CR contacted dealers to learn that the average cost of replacing the fob of a key is between $200 to $400. This could quickly add up if your insurance company requires you to pay a $500 deductible.

It's a lot easier than you think to replace the car key fob. The majority of the time the dead fob is simply the matter of replacing its battery. Keys that are older, typically from the mid-1990s or before are powered by a tiny CR2032 battery that you can find online or at a lot of big-box stores. They are simple to replace by using a thin flat-bladed screwdriver or your fingernail to pry apart the two halves of the fob in order to access the battery. Remove the old battery and then insert a brand new one, making sure to align it correctly and note the + and - markings on the battery case. Reassemble the fob shell and test the remote buttons to make sure they work.

In the case of an electronic key malfunctioning Some key fobs come with a mechanical slot that can be used to open the doors and start the car. But, it depends on the make and model of your car. Some have the key slot located under or behind the door handle. others require you to push the fob to open the trunk and reveal the key slot.
